keyed-lock 0.2.3

A keyed lock for synchronization.
Documentation
[dependencies.parking_lot]
features = ["arc_lock"]
version = "0.12"

[dependencies.tokio]
features = ["sync"]
optional = true
version = "1"

[dev-dependencies.tokio]
features = ["full"]
version = "1"

[features]
async = ["tokio"]
default = ["sync", "async"]
send_guard = ["parking_lot/send_guard"]
sync = []

[lib]
name = "keyed_lock"
path = "src/lib.rs"

[package]
autobenches = false
autobins = false
autoexamples = false
autolib = false
autotests = false
build = false
categories = ["concurrency"]
description = "A keyed lock for synchronization."
edition = "2021"
keywords = ["lock", "mutex", "keyed-lock", "named-lock", "async"]
license = "MIT"
name = "keyed-lock"
readme = "README.md"
repository = "https://github.com/ldm0/keyed-lock"
version = "0.2.3"